After Hockey Player In Soorma, Taapsee Pannu To Play Cricketer In Mithali Raj’s Biopic?

By  Karan Nanda July 3rd 2019 01:27 PM

After winning the hearts with her performance as a Hockey player in Diljit Dosanjh starrer Soorma, versatile actress Taapsee Pannu will now reportedly portray a role of a cricketer on big screen.

According to the media reports, Taapsee Pannu is set to play Mithali Raj, captain of the Indian women's ODI cricket team, in her next film. The reports further suggested that the actress has given her nod to portray Mithali Raj in her biopic.

However, there is no official word on the development.

Earlier, Taapsee spoke to PTI about Mithali Raj biopic. She said: "The script is not in place so it's too early to talk about it. Right now, they are collecting material and the script has not been written yet. If they offer me, I will be very happy. I really want to do a sports biopic."

Mithali is the highest run-scorer in women's international cricket and the only woman cricketer to surpass the 6,000 run mark in ODIs.
